BBDU Strengthens Its Position as Lucknow's Leading Placement Hub with Offers from Infosys and Wipro

BBDU students secure placement opportunities with Infosys and Wipro, including packages of Rs. 9.50 lakh and Rs. 6.25 lakh per annum, strengthening the university’s career-focused education profile in Lucknow.

 

Babu Banarasi Das University (BBDU), one of North India’s leading multidisciplinary universities, has strengthened its position as a career-focused higher education destination in Lucknow after students secured placement opportunities with leading global technology and business services companies, including Infosys and Wipro.

In the latest placement drive, Wipro selected BBDU students for the role of Customer Service Representative, Human Resource Outsourcing. Meanwhile, students secured placements with Infosys at packages of Rs. 9.50 lakh per annum and Rs. 6.25 lakh per annum.

Students selected at Rs. 9.50 lakh per annum have been offered the role of Specialist Programmer L1 (Trainee), while those receiving Rs. 6.25 lakh per annum have been selected as Digital Specialist Engineer (Trainee).

The placements reflect the University’s focus on equipping students with industry-relevant knowledge, technical expertise and professional competencies required to succeed in a rapidly evolving employment landscape.

Viraj Sagar Das, Pro-Chancellor, Babu Banarasi Das University, said, “At BBDU, our focus has always been to ensure that education translates into meaningful career opportunities. These placements with leading organizations such as Infosys and Wipro reflect the strength of our academic ecosystem, industry engagement and continued efforts to prepare students for the future of work. We are proud to see our students take confident steps towards successful professional careers and contribute to the growing talent ecosystem of Lucknow and Uttar Pradesh.”

BBDU’s placement ecosystem is supported by its industry-aligned curriculum, experiential learning opportunities, advanced academic infrastructure, career mentoring and structured corporate engagement. Through its Corporate Connect Programme, the University enables students to engage with industry experts, participate in internships and live projects, and gain exposure to evolving workplace expectations.

With a legacy of nearly three decades in education, BBDU continues to build a bridge between academia and industry. The University’s multidisciplinary approach, emphasis on emerging technologies, innovation-led learning and extensive corporate engagement enable students to develop domain expertise and workplace readiness.

To date, more than 1,200 companies have recruited from BBDU, resulting in over 12,500 placement offers, with the highest package reaching Rs. 48 lakh per annum.

The latest placements with Infosys and Wipro further reinforce BBDU’s focus on creating strong career pathways for students and strengthening Lucknow’s position as a growing hub for skilled, future-ready talent.
